Jon Jones injured, Davis to step in against Evans
Posted by Staff (04/27/2011 @ 8:00 am)
UFC light heavyweight champion Jon Jones has been forced out of his UFC 133 bout against Rashad Evans, and Phil Davis has stepped in for the August bout writes Nate Lawson of HeavyMMA.com.
Light heavyweight champion Jon Jones will not meet Rashad Evans later this year.
Neil Davidson of the Canadian Press broke the news today that the champion was forced out of the contest and that the fast-rising Phil Davis will step in against Evans at UFC 133 this August.
According to MMAjunkie.com, Jones has been sidelined due to a torn right hand ligament, and the recovery will apparently be a lengthy one. A timetable has not been set, though.
Jones defeated former champion Mauricio “Shogun” Rua at UFC 128 last month to earn the light heavyweight strap. Immediately following the fight, former champion Evans entered the cage, and the pair agreed to fight for the championship later this year.

Mayhem Miller vs. Aaron Simpson added to UFC 132
Posted by Staff (04/25/2011 @ 8:59 am)
HeavyMMA.com writes that Jason “Mayhem” Miller will face Aaron Simpson at UFC 132 in July.
Returning middleweight Jason “Mayhem” Miller has been under contract to the UFC for less than two days, and he already has a fight scheduled. That’s a far cry from his Strikeforce days, where Miller would go months without getting a single fight booked.
Miller will face tough wrestler Aaron Simpson at UFC 132 in July. HeavyMMA.com confirmed the news with sources close to the promotion on Saturday morning. The Miller/Simpson bout is expected to be a part of the night’s pay per view telecast.
Miller hasn’t fought loss an August victory over Kazushi Sakuraba in DREAM last year, and hasn’t competed in North America in just over one year, ever since his involvement in the famed Nashville brawl with members of the Cesar Gracie camp. Miller inked his new UFC contract late this week.
Simpson earned a unanimous decision over Mario Miranda in March, getting back on track after consecutive losses to Chris Leben and Mark Munoz.
UFC 132 is headlined by a UFC bantamweight title bout between Dominick Cruz and Urijah Faber.

Vitor Beltort vs. Yoshihiro Akiyama set for UFC 133
Posted by Staff (04/22/2011 @ 8:05 am)
HeavyMMA.com writes that Vitor Belfort will return to the Octagon at UFC 133 when he faces Yoshihiro Akiyama.
Vitor Belfort will return to the Octagon for the first time since a stunning knockout loss to Anderson Silva in January when he faces Yoshihiro Akiyama at UFC 133.
The event is scheduled for Aug. 6 in Philadelphia.
Silva used a front kick to the jaw to finish Belfort in their middleweight title fight in January. It was Belfort’s first fight in the UFC middleweight division after dismantling Rich Franklin in a catchweight bout in his return to the promotion.
Akiyama will look to put an end to a two-fight losing streak. He was scheduled to face Chael Sonnen in March, but Sonnen’s suspension by the UFC put an end to the bout. Nate Marquardt replaced Sonnen, but Akiyama was forced to pull out of that fight after the tragic earthquakes in Japan left him unable to travel.

Shogun Rua vs. Forrest Griffin 2 official for UFC Rio
Posted by Staff (04/17/2011 @ 9:56 am)
A light heavyweight rematch between Mauricio Rua and Forrest Griffin is set for Brazil this August at UFC 134 according to HeavyMMA.com.
A light heavyweight tilt rematch between Forrest Griffin and Mauricio “Shogun” Rua is set for “UFC Rio.”
UFC president Dana White confirmed the news to MMAFighting.com earlier today.
The two first met back at UFC 76, the event where Rua made his debut with the promotion. The former PRIDE superstar failed to capitalize, however, as he was submitted by Griffin in what was one of the more improbable victories in the history of the UFC.
Since then, Griffin has earned and lost the 205 lb. title, while Rua has done the same. The Brazilian is coming off a technical knockout loss to Jon Jones which lost him the title, while Griffin is still on the road back with consecutive wins over Tito Ortiz and Rich Franklin.
“UFC Rio,” also known as UFC 134, is set for Rio de Janeiro, Brazil on August 27 and features a middleweight title fight between champion Anderson Silva and top contender Yushin Okami.

UFC Rio: Silva, Okami Booked For Main Event Title Bout
Posted by Staff (04/14/2011 @ 9:03 am)
Yushin Okami, the last man to beat Anderson Silva, will finally get his shot at the title when he faces Silva again at UFC Rio according to HeavyMMA.com.
Yushin Okami was the last man to beat Anderson Silva. At “UFC Rio,” he’ll finally get his long-awaited crack at the middleweight title.
UFC President Dana White confirmed the bout with USA Today on Wednesday afternoon. The news puts an end to the idea that welterweight champion Georges St. Pierre will move up to challenge for Silva’s title.
Okami defeated Nate Marquardt in November to earn his shot at the middleweight title. He defeated Silva via disqualification back in 2006 when Silva used an illegal upkick at a Rumble on the Rock show. Silva is undefeated since that lone loss, while Okami has gone 12-3 in the same span.

B.J. Penn removed from July 2 UFC 132 fight card
Posted by Staff (04/08/2011 @ 8:46 am)
According to HeavyMMA.com, UFC welterweight contender B.J. Penn has been scratched from UFC 132.
Former UFC lightweight and welterweight champion B.J. Penn will not be fighting at UFC 132 this July.
MMAjunkie.com reported the news earlier today after confirming the information with sources close to Penn’s camp.
A rematch between Penn and Jon Fitch was scratched from the card after the American Kickboxing Academy star was forced out of the contest due an injury. While it was believed that the UFC was searching for a replacement, the sources say that Penn will be fighting on a different card later this year.
Penn and Fitch fought a draw at UFC 127 last February and an immediate rematch was set in place for the two. The winner of the rematch would have in all likelihood been the next man to earn a title shot against the winner of Georges St. Pierre vs. Jake Shields.
UFC 132 is set for July 2 in Las Vegas, Nevada and features a bantamweight championship between rivals Dominick Cruz and Urijah Faber. A replacement co-main event has yet to be announced.

Yves Edwards vs. Sam Stout official for UFC 131
Posted by Staff (04/07/2011 @ 8:58 am)
Sam Stout vs. Yves Edwards is now official for UFC 131 in Vancouver according to HeavyMMA.com.
UFC officials announced the match up earlier this week.
Edwards last competed at “UFC: Fight for the Troops 2″ this past January, earning an impression submission victory over Cody McKenzie late in the second round of their contest. Prior to that fight, Edwards defeated John Gunderson via unanimous decision at “UFC Fight Night: Marquardt vs. Palhares.” The bout marked his return to the UFC after a four year absence.
Meanwhile, Stout has yet to compete in 2011, but he did end off 2010 with a victory, defeating Paul Taylor via split-decision at UFC 121 last October. The win was his third in four fights with the other victories coming over Joe Lauzon and Matt Wiman. His lone loss since 2009 came against Jeremy Stephens at UFC 113.
UFC 131 is set for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ada on June 11 and features a heavyweight main event between Brock Lesnar and Junior dos Santos. Edwards vs. Stout is the eleventh bout to be made official for the highly-anticipated event.

Wanderlei Silva vs. Chris Leben added to UFC 132
Posted by Staff (04/05/2011 @ 9:20 am)
According to HeavyMMA.com, a middleweight clash between heavy-handed brawlers Chris Leben and Wanderlei Silva has come to fruition, as the two will meet at UFC 132 this July.
A middleweight bout between Wanderlei Silva and Chris Leben is official for UFC 132 in Las Vegas, Nevada for the promotion’s annual Fourth of July weekend event.
UFC officials announced the bout on Monday.
Leben, who experienced a career resurgence with dominant victory over Jay Silva, Aaron Simpson, and Yoshihiro Akiyama in 2010, was disappointed against Brian Stann, losing via technical knockout at UFC 125 last January. He is an even 3-3 over his past three years of competition in the UFC.
Silva, meanwhile, jumped back on the right track in his last contest with a unanimous decision victory over Michael Bisping at UFC 110. The former PRIDE superstar has been out of action since the early 2010 victory, which was his debut at the 185 lb. mark.
